Lilly's Story
Sweet Lily <br/><br/>Our sweet senior girl has a sad story. Recently, Lily was found by police in her home with her deceased owner and unfortunately ended up at the county shelter. There wasn't any family to take her She was so stressed, so we rushed to get her. We'll never know how long she stayed by her owner before help came <br/><br/>Lily is the sweetest 12-year-old Labrador that you will ever meet. When we first met her, she was so clearly heartbroken, confused, quiet, and just... so sad. Her whole world had changed overnight. But even through that, her gentle, loving nature still shines. She's great with other dogs, cats and every person she meets. <br/><br/>As with any senior dog, she does have typical old dog stuff and is a big girl at about 78lbs. The main thing we have been working to fix is urine incontinence. She is on meds (Proin) for that and we're just waiting/hoping it works. She goes to the bathroom outside, but tends to leak urine on her back legs, so she wears a diaper most of the time (the only issue is urine) and has to be kept clean and dry. She's an easy guest other than that. <br/><br/>Her foster family works full time outside of the home, so they aren't able to manage this as good as someone who is home all day. So - we are looking for either a new foster home or someone with a big heart for a senior girl that wants to adopt her. We'd love for her to have a permanent home again.
